In this episode of Podcast, host Will Lukang interviews Eric Ebron, a leadership consultant and founder of SME Consulting. Ebron shares his career journey, from his time in the United States Marine Corps to his current role as a director in the aerospace industry. He discusses his passion for developing leaders and the importance of nurturing talent and filling the leadership pipeline. Ebron also emphasizes the need for effective leadership, which includes using personnel efficiently, maintaining low costs, boosting morale, and preparing teams for future challenges. He highlights the role of mentoring in leadership development and the importance of balancing nurturing and coaching to address problem areas. Ebron identifies the biggest challenge in developing leaders as the rapid pace of change in today's world, but also sees it as an opportunity for organizations to invest in leadership development programs. He shares a success story of coaching a young leader and the transformational impact it had on their career. Ebron concludes by offering three key takeaways for developing leaders: find a mentor, make the most efficient use of personnel, and seize opportunities for growth.
